Understanding Bingo Halls in the UK
Bingo halls have long been a staple of British social culture, offering a unique blend of entertainment and community feeling. In the UK, these establishments are regulated by the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), ensuring a safe and fair environment for players. The traditional game of bingo, often associated with small stakes and well-disposed contention, has evolved to include electronic bingo terminals and digital interfaces, yet the core experience remains centred around the communal aspect. Players typically purchase printed tickets or make use of electronic dabbers to mark numbers as they are called out, with the aim of completing a specific pattern to win a appreciate. New bingo halls often feature bars, restaurants, and live entertainment, making them a destination for social outings. The UKGC mandates strict age verification (18+), responsible gambling measures, and transparency in appreciate distribution, which are all critical to maintaining corporate trust. For those new to the scene, it is advisable to start with a small budget, understand the rules of each title variant (such as 90-glob or 75-ball bingo), and dodge chasing losses. Bingo halls in the UK also support local charities through dedicated charity bingo nights, contributing to community welfare. The social aspect is a key draw, with players often forming friendships and attending regularly. Yet, as with any take shape of gambling, it is important to set limits and recognise when play ceases to be fun. The UKGC’s resources, such as GamCare and GamStop, provide assist for those who may acquire problem gambling behaviours. Overall, bingo halls offer a regulated, low-stakes gambling option that prioritises social interaction and entertainment.
The Rise of Online Bingo Sites
Online bingo has experienced significant growth in the UK, particularly since the early 2000s, with digital platforms replicating the social experience of physical halls while adding convenience and variety. UKGC-licensed online bingo sites are now a major segment of the non-branded gambling market, offering a full range of games including 90-ball, 80-ball, 75-ball, and speed bingo. These platforms often incorporate schmooze rooms, themed rooms, and progressive jackpots to enhance player engagement. Unlike land-based bingo, online versions allow players to purchase tickets in advance, participate in multiple games simultaneously, and access promotions such as deposit bonuses, free tickets, and loyalty rewards. The legal framework in the UK requires these sites to implement robust age verification, self-exclusion tools, and deposit limits to promote responsible gambling. Players can enjoy bingo on desktop and mobile devices, with apps providing seamless gameplay and notifications for upcoming games. The social component remains entire, with chat moderators (often called ‘callers’) interacting with players and facilitating community events. However, players should be cautious of unlicensed operators that may not adhere to UKGC standards. Always check for the UKGC logo and verify the licence number on the regulator’s website. Online bingo also offers lower minimum stakes compared to some other forms of gambling, making it accessible to a broader audience. For those interested in trying online bingo, it is recommended to scan the terms and conditions carefully, especially regarding wagering requirements on bonuses. The variety of games and the ability to play from home have made online bingo a favoured selection, but it is essential to maintain a balanced approach and avoid excessive play.

Understanding Bonuses and Promotions
Bonuses and promotions are a major draw for many players, but they amount with nuances that require careful understanding. No deposit bonuses allow you to try games without risking your own money, but they often have higher wagering requirements and maximum cashout limits. Free spins offers are popular for slot enthusiasts, yet they may be restricted to specific games and experience expiry dates. Match deposit bonuses can boost your budget significantly, but always work out the effective value after wagering requirements are met. In 2026, some UK casinos are introducing innovative loyalty programmes that reward consistent play with cashback or exclusive perks. It is vital to come on these offers with a clear strategy—never chase bonuses beyond your way, and always prioritise sites that provide transparent terms.

Tips for Gambling Responsibly Online
Gambling is purely for adults aged 18 and over. All UK-licensed casinos are regulated by the Gambling Commission (UKGC). For self-exclusion, you can use GAMSTOP, the national online scheme to block access to all UK gambling sites. If you need help, GamCare and BeGambleAware offer support via the National Gambling Helpline on 0808 8020 133. Always set deposit and time limits before you play, and treat gambling as entertainment only — never chase losses. Stay in control and gamble responsibly.
